Cloves have been valued for centuries in traditional wellness practices because of their strong aroma, warming properties, and concentrated plant compounds.

These small dried flower buds come from the Syzygium aromaticum tree and have long been used in herbal drinks, digestive remedies, teas, and natural home preparations throughout Asia, the Middle East, and Africa.

In recent years, warm clove water has become increasingly popular as a simple morning wellness drink.

Many people drink it on an empty stomach because they believe it may help support digestion, circulation, oral health, and overall wellness naturally.

While clove water is not a miracle cure or detox solution, cloves do contain biologically active compounds – especially eugenol – that researchers continue studying for their antioxidant and antimicrobial properties.

Drinking warm clove water consistently for several days may affect the body in subtle ways, especially when combined with healthy lifestyle habits.

Why Cloves Are Considered So Powerful

Cloves are extremely rich in aromatic compounds.

The most important is eugenol, which gives cloves their:

  • Strong scent
  • Warming sensation
  • Distinct flavor

Eugenol is widely studied because of its antioxidant and antimicrobial activity.

Cloves also contain:

  • Polyphenols
  • Flavonoids
  • Manganese
  • Antioxidant compounds

Even small amounts of cloves contain surprisingly concentrated plant chemicals.

Why Cloves Feel Cooling and Warming at the Same Time

Eugenol creates a unique sensation because it may temporarily stimulate certain nerve receptors involved in temperature and sensation.

This is one reason cloves feel:

  • Slightly warming
  • Slightly numbing
  • Intensely aromatic

How to Make Warm Clove Water

Simple Clove Water Recipe

Add:

  • 3–5 whole cloves

to:

  • 1 cup hot water

Let steep for:

  • 5–10 minutes

Some people also add:

  • Cinnamon
  • Lemon
  • Ginger
  • Honey

for flavor.

Drink warm, preferably in the morning.

Why Moderation Matters With Cloves

Cloves are highly concentrated.

Large amounts may irritate:

  • The stomach
  • Mouth tissues
  • Digestive lining

Excessive clove intake is not recommended.

Small culinary or tea amounts are generally considered much gentler.
